RESTORE_WC_MEMORY回调函数 (video.h)

VideoPortRestoreWCMemory 回调例程在调用 videoPortProtectWCMemory 回调例程后,将写入合并的视频内存从受保护状态还原。

语法

RESTORE_WC_MEMORY RestoreWcMemory;

VP_STATUS RestoreWcMemory(
  [in] IN PVOID Context,
  [in] IN PVOID HwDeviceExtension
)
{...}

参数

[in] Context

指向要传递给 CallbackRoutine调用方确定的上下文参数的指针。 它通常指向 VIDEO_PORT_CONFIG_INFO 缓冲区。

[in] HwDeviceExtension

指向微型端口驱动程序的硬件设备扩展的指针。

返回值

VideoPortRestoreWCMemory 如果成功还原写入组合视频内存,则返回NO_ERROR;否则,它将返回ERROR_INVALID_FUNCTION或ERROR_NOT_ENOUGH_MEMORY的错误状态。

言论

调用 VideoPortProtectWCMemory 回调例程后,在调用 videoPortRestoreWCMemory 之前,CPU 无法写入写入合并内存。

要求

要求 价值
最低支持的客户端 在 Windows 2000 及更高版本的 Windows作系统中可用。
目标平台 桌面
标头 video.h (include Video.h)

另请参阅

VIDEO_PORT_CONFIG_INFO

VideoPortProtectWCMemory